Students wear empty holsters to protest campus ban of concealed weapons
By Stefanie Cainto on April 9th, 2013 | Last updated: April 9, 2013 at 6:03 pm
Students for Concealed Carry at the University of Florida is organizing its third annual empty holster protest, where members wear gun holsters without weapons in them to protest the concealed carry ban on campus.

Tax proposal on guns, ammunitions for mental health treatment
By Lauren Lettelier on March 1st, 2013 | Last updated: March 7, 2013 at 2:16 pm
Wednesday a Tampa Sen. Arthenia Joyner proposed a tax on dealers’s sale of guns and ammunition. The bill would place a four percent tax on dealers, with plans the money would go to mental health treatment and awareness.
Four arrested for homicide involvement in Clay County
By Rebekah Geier on February 14th, 2013 | Last updated: February 14, 2013 at 5:14 pm
Almost exactly a year after the homicide of Clay County Detective David White, four men were arrested on Thursday in connection to the theft and transfer of the gun White was killed with.
Florida sees increase in request for gun permits
By Luis Giraldo on November 27th, 2012 | Last updated: November 28, 2012 at 10:46 am
The increase in gun permit requests may indicate people’s uncertainties about the economy, said some gun supporters. The increase happened the day after the November elections.
